Meeting notes — Reel transfer, Holloway Film Trust archive. Twelve nitrate-era reels crated Tuesday. Crates sealed, humidity cards inside. No stacking above two high. Dock B only; freight lift out of service. Courier from Vexley Transit arrives 09:30 sharp, ten-minute window. Warehouse lead signs manifest, keeps yellow copy. Reels never left unattended on the dock. The hand-over instruction for the courier is as follows.

handover note for yagef-bagep: the drudor pelius courier leaves the kasdor zorvan norir ledger at gate 8016 under passcode 755406

FAQ: Why does MatchGrid pause during peak hours?

The MatchGrid matching service runs full garbage-collection cycles when heap pressure spikes, causing brief pairing stalls. These are expected under load and clear within seconds. If a pause exceeds one minute, restart the match coordinator via the recovery console, which requires the standing passphrase. That passphrase is recorded immediately below.

vault phrase of yadug-bawep = wenix-sorael-norwyn-belwyn-istix-ulaath-briael-eliok-fenir-silok-frair-casix-holox-praax

Your plugin hooks run *after* the backfill window closes,
// so don't assume yesterday's partitions exist before then. The client retries
// twice with jitter, then gives up and pages the Bramblewick on-call rotation.
// Keep your handlers idempotent — reruns happen more often than you'd like.
// The scheduler authenticates against the internal Lanternfeed API, so you'll
// need a key for it. Drop your key on the next line.

gateway credential: kto23_LX9A4ys6i4nzHtpOLNLodKK